Char Dham Yatra Challenges and Easy Ways to Tackle Them
1. High Altitude
The elevated altitudes of the Char Dham sites can lead to altitude sickness, causing symptoms like headaches, nausea, and dizziness.
Preparation and Prevention
Medical Check-Up: Before commencing the Yatra, undergo a comprehensive medical examination to ensure you’re fit for high-altitude travel.
Acclimatization: Allow a day for your body to adjust to reduced oxygen levels.
Hydration and Nutrition: Maintain adequate hydration and consume a balanced diet to keep energy levels stable.
Medication: Consult with a healthcare provider about medicines like acetazolamide (Diamox) that can help prevent altitude sickness.

2. Trekking Routes
The pilgrimage involves traversing rugged and steep terrains, which can be challenging, especially for older people and those unfamiliar with such conditions.
Preparation and Support
Physical Fitness: Engage in regular cardiovascular and strength training exercises prior to the Yatra to build stamina and muscle strength.
Use of Assistive Services: Consider hiring local porters or utilizing mule services to carry luggage, reducing physical strain.
Rest Intervals: Take regular breaks during treks to rest and acclimate.
Helicopter Services: For those unable to undertake strenuous treks, helicopter services are available for certain segments of the Yatra.

Yamunotri Dham Challenges
3. Limited Medical Facilities
Yamunotri is situated in a remote area with minimal medical infrastructure. In emergencies, immediate medical assistance may not be readily available, posing risks for pilgrims with health concerns.
Preparation and Precautions
Carry a First Aid Kit: Include essentials like bandages, antiseptics, pain relievers, and any personal medications.
Emergency Contacts: Keep a list of emergency contact numbers, including local health centers and authorities.
Travel Insurance: Consider purchasing travel insurance that covers medical evacuation in case of emergencies.

4. Overcrowding
During peak pilgrimage seasons, Yamunotri experiences significant overcrowding.
Strategies to Mitigate Overcrowding
Off-Peak Travel: Plan your visit during shoulder seasons or weekdays to avoid peak crowds.
Advance Bookings: Be sure to reserve accommodations and any required permits to ensure availability.
Local Guidance: Hire local guides who are familiar with less crowded routes and times.
Gangotri Dham Challenges
5. Landslide-Prone Areas
The route to Gangotri passes through regions susceptible to landslides, especially during the monsoon season. These landslides can block paths and pose dangers to travellers.
Safety Measures
Weather Monitoring: Stay updated on weather forecasts and avoid travel during heavy rainfall periods.
Local Advice: Consult local authorities or guides about current road conditions before proceeding.
Emergency Preparedness: Familiarize yourself with emergency procedures and nearest safe zones along the route.

6. Accommodation Facilities
Gangotri has a limited number of lodging options, which can lead to difficulties in securing accommodations during peak seasons.
Accommodation Strategies
Advance Reservations: Book accommodations well in advance, especially during peak pilgrimage seasons.
Alternative Lodging: Consider staying in nearby towns with more lodging options and commuting to the Dham.
Flexible Itinerary: Be prepared to adjust your travel plans based on accommodation availability.
Kedarnath Dham Challenges
7. Unpredictable Weather
Kedarnath is renowned for its rapidly changing weather, characterized by sudden temperature drops and unexpected snowfall, even during summer. The unpredictability of the weather can catch pilgrims off guard and put them at risk for health problems.
Preparation and Vigilance
Layered Clothing: Dress in layers to adjust to sudden temperature changes.
Weather Updates: Regularly check weather forecasts and heed any advisories.
Contingency Plans: Have backup plans in case of weather-related delays or route closures.

8. Natural Disasters
The 2013 flash floods in Kedarnath resulted in significant loss of life and infrastructure damage. The region’s vulnerability to such natural calamities remains a concern for pilgrims.
Risk Mitigation
Stay Informed: Keep abreast of any geological activity reports or warnings in the area.
Emergency Training: Participate in any available briefings or training sessions on disaster response.
Local Coordination: Coordinate with local authorities and follow their guidance during emergencies.

Badrinath Dham Challenges
9. Risk of Avalanches
The area around Badrinath is prone to avalanches, especially during certain times of the year, posing risks to pilgrims travelling to and from the site.
Safety Precautions
Seasonal Timing: Plan your visit during periods with lower avalanche risks, typically before the onset of heavy snowfall.
Route Selection: Stick to established paths known to be safer and less prone to avalanches.
Local Expertise: Engage local guides who are knowledgeable about current snow conditions and risks.

10. Limited Accessibility
Due to heavy snowfall and harsh weather conditions, access to Badrinath becomes highly restricted, making it challenging for pilgrims who plan their visit.
Planning and Flexibility
Seasonal Awareness: Be aware of the Dham’s official opening and closing dates and plan accordingly.
Transportation Arrangements: Confirm the availability of transportation options during your planned visit.
Alternative Plans: Have alternative pilgrimage sites or activities in mind in case access is restricted.
